Output 64fd334de76bd8d3e5ce7ab0839d3ad002e0bcfe1cef33537c529e0271249b5a:0

value
58095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a69a391bf6a3b1aeb3d208515574608f09bb6400 OP_EQUAL
address
3GsvqzgKTVkpGYQHgTZRC3rSMSEaJnTEPZ
transaction
64fd334de76bd8d3e5ce7ab0839d3ad002e0bcfe1cef33537c529e0271249b5a
confirmations
221474
spent
true